在网络通信中,报文(message)扮演着至关重要的角色,它是数据传输的基本单元,包含了完整的信息内容,其长度可以是任意的,既非固定也不受限。报文的类型和结构可以根据网络协议的需要进行自由报文和数字报文等形式的划分。
在传输过程中,报文通常会被拆分成更小的单位,如分组、包或帧,进行逐一传输。这种拆分是通过在报文头部添加特定格式的数据段来完成的,这些数据段包含了诸如报文类型、版本、长度、实体等重要信息,以确保数据的正确传输和理解。
以TCP/IP协议为例,报文头部结构具有明确的定义。例如,IP首部(IP_HEADER)包含了首部长度、IP版本、服务类型、总长度、标识符等字段,用于标识和校验IP数据包。TCP首部(TCP_HEADER)则更为详细,包括源和目的端口、序列号、确认号、窗口大小以及校验和等,这些信息对于TCP连接管理和数据完整性至关重要。
IP_HEADER中的total_len字段,指示了实际数据内容的长度,其他字段如源IP地址、目的IP地址等也对数据传输起到关键作用。这些头部信息共同构成了报文的骨架,帮助接收者解析和处理接收到的数据内容。
总的来说,报文头部的结构设计是网络通信设计的核心,它们通过标准化的方式,确保了数据在网络中的准确传输和理解,无论是对于数据的长度控制,还是对于数据的有序处理,都起到了至关重要的作用。
本文地址: http://www.goggeous.com/e/1/1179347
文章来源:天狐定制
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-08职业培训
2025-01-04 22:12:25职业培训
2025-01-04 22:12:17职业培训
2025-01-04 22:12:15职业培训
2025-01-04 22:12:14职业培训
2025-01-04 22:12:14职业培训
2025-01-04 22:12:13职业培训
2025-01-04 22:12:13职业培训
2025-01-04 22:12:04职业培训
2025-01-04 22:12:03职业培训
2025-01-04 22:12:02职业培训
2025-01-02 19:47职业培训
2024-12-01 23:38职业培训
2024-12-10 18:03职业培训
2024-12-09 15:26职业培训
2024-12-21 23:48职业培训
2025-01-07 09:59职业培训
2024-11-26 05:29职业培训
2024-12-04 08:03职业培训
2024-11-26 21:30职业培训
2024-12-18 00:44职业培训
扫码二维码
获取最新动态